In the long-awaited follow-up to the beloved classic Frindle, a new generation of kids discovers the power of words and imagination—and yes, even screens—to solve a mystery and change their world!
¡°A fitting final work from a master storyteller.¡±—Kirkus Reviews
Josh Willet is a techie, a serious gamer. Which is why Josh and his friends can¡¯t stand Mr. N¡¯s ELA class; it¡¯s a strict no-tech zone. Mr. N makes them write everything out by hand, he won¡¯t use a Smartboard, and he¡¯s obsessed with some hundred-year-old grammar book. Then Josh discovers a secret; turns out Mr. N's been keeping a lot more than technology from his students! Together with his best friend Vanessa, and using all the computer skills they¡¯ve got, Josh is determined to solve the mystery of Mr. N¡¯s past. And maybe get some screentime back, too?
Andrew Clements¡¯s final novel is a timely one—about the importance of language, the changes that come along with technology (good and bad), and how sometimes you have to challenge what you think you know. Set a whole generation later, this novel can be read on its own or alongside Frindle and is destined to become another timeless classic.
